Transaction 7e80fcbf90990770aa15b69dc479825a85ec774fc0b02339cb76f9161944c7ba

1 Input
2 Outputs
  • 7e80fcbf90990770aa15b69dc479825a85ec774fc0b02339cb76f9161944c7ba:0
  • value  6638300292
    address  2N4jNKTCAcF4rjn3PugnJbHVGCYRPBTPpjy
  • 7e80fcbf90990770aa15b69dc479825a85ec774fc0b02339cb76f9161944c7ba:1
  • value  1128026
    address  2N5Lb4YJeVEc1bKkEfBJVCs8XW34kjboWNk